Complete guide to Bronx

Things to do in Bronx

Discover the best of Bronx — top attractions, local food, transport tips, budget advice, and currency essentials. Plan your perfect Bronx trip today.

  • Recommended

The Bronx Museum of the Arts

Contemporary art museum known for exhibitions focused on Bronx, New York, and global urban culture. A strong free cultural stop on the Grand Concourse.

  • Recommended

Edgar Allan Poe Cottage

Small historic house museum where Edgar Allan Poe spent his final years. Worth visiting for literary history and a rare preserved 19th-century Bronx home.

  • Recommended

The Hip Hop Museum

Museum project dedicated to preserving and presenting hip-hop history, especially its Bronx origins. Significant for music culture, though access may vary by exhibition phase.

United States Dollar

Food and daily costs are moderate by New York City standards, but hotel prices nearby can be high.

Average meal costs

Budget
USD 8-15 for deli, pizza, or fast food.
Mid-range
USD 20-40 per person at a casual restaurant.
Fine dining
USD 70+ per person at upscale spots.
Coffee
USD 3-6 for drip coffee or a latte.

Tipping culture

Tip 18-20% in sit-down restaurants. USD 1-2 per drink at bars, round up taxis, and tip delivery drivers USD 3-5 or 15-20%.

In the Bronx, NY, travelers should be cautious of pickpocketing and petty theft, especially in crowded areas like transit hubs and popular attractions. It's important to remain aware of surroundings and avoid displaying valuables openly. Some common scams include fare evasion schemes on public transportation and unofficial taxi services; using licensed yellow cabs or rideshare apps is safer. Travelers are advised to stay in well-lit, populated areas at night and be wary of unsolicited offers or distractions designed to divert attention.
